2Include information about your site on your Wall and in the photo gallery
Facebook gives you the chance to write a lot about you and your endeavors, as well as to include pics, so use all these opportunities to build interest in you and your products. It is even better to post videos and fill in the other tabs, so if you have something meaningful to put there, do it.
1 Your profile is your major weapon
As with Twitter and any other social network, if you don’t make your profile interesting, you will not very become popular. Give background information for you and don’t forget to make your profile public because this way even people, who don’t know you, when they encounter your profile, they might become interested in you and become a supporter of yours.
3Build your network
As with other social networking sites, your network is your major capital. That is why you need to invite your friends, acquaintances, and partners and ask them to join as your supporter. You ought to also search for people with interests similar to yours. However, don’t be pushy and don’t spam because this is not the way to convince people to join your network.
4Post regularly
No matter how interesting the stuff in your Facebook profile is, if you don’t publish new content regularly, the traffic to your Facebook profile (and respectively the Facebook traffic to your site) will slow down. If you can post every day, it is fine but even if you don’t post that regularly, try to do it as frequently as you can. If nothing else, updating your status regularly is over nothing, so do it.
6Arrange your page
Unlike other social networks, Facebook gives you more flexibility and you can move around plenty of of the boxes. If you put the RSS feed with the links to your blog in a visible space, this alone can generate plenty of traffic for you.
5Be active
A great profile, an impressive network, and posting regularly are a part of the recipe for success on Facebook. You also need to be active – visit the profiles of your supporters, take part in their groups and other initiatives, visit their sites. You are right that all this takes a lot of time and you might soon discover that Facebooking is a full-time occupation but if you notice an increase in traffic to your site, then all this is worth.
7Check what Facebook apps are available
Facebook apps are numerous and new and new ones are released all the time. While plenty of of these apps are not exactly what you need, there’s apps, which can work for you in a great way. For instance, MarketPlace widget/plugin or Blog Friends widget are very useful and you ought to take advantage of them. You can also use the widgets for crossposting (i.e. posting directly on Twitter from Facebook) because this saves you time.
8Use Facebook Social Ads
If you cannot get traffic the natural way, you might think about using Facebook Social ads. These are PPC ads and beginning a campaign is similar to an Adwords campaign.
9Start a group
There’s plenty of groups on Facebook but it is probable that there is a free niche for you. Start a group about something related to your business and invite people to join it. The advantage of this approach is that you are getting targeted users – i.e. people, who are interested in you, your product, your ideas, etc.
10 Write your own Facebook extensions
While this step is certainly not for everybody, if you can write Facebook extensions, this is four more way to make your Facebook profile popular and get some traffic to your site.

11Use separate profiles
Unfortunately, social networks do expose a lot of personal information and you are not paranoid, if you don’t need so much publicity. Plenty of people are rightfully worried about their privacy on social network sites and that is why it is not uncommon to have four personal profile for friends and four business profile to promote their business. You can have four single profile for both purposes, but if you have privacy concerns, think about separating this profile in four – you’d better be safe than sorry.
